Inner problems like burst pipes and also overflows can result in emergency flooding. Maintain on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Switch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can burst due to cold tem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ater issues, and also various other aspects. No matter the cause, you need to act promptly to make sure porous home materials, home appliances, and furnishings do not absorb the water, resulting in damage. Turn off the main shutoff prior to you do any type of cleaning to make sure water quits pouring in. Killing the water resource is basic, and it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the ruptured pipe, ask for emergency situation pipes services to repair it right away.

2. Shut Off the Breaker

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electric outlets, it can trigger injuries or deaths.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Crucial Wet Times

When it pertains to conserving your home furnishings and also devices, time is essential. For this reason, you have to move whatever whet possessions you can from the damaged area to a dry area. This hinders further damages since the longer they soak in water, the extra extensive the problem.

4. Document the Level of Damage

Take note of all the damage caused by the ruptured pipeline. With documents, you can additionally obtain a clear picture of the degree of the damages.

5. Remove Water ASAP

You have to get rid of excess water as soon as possible. Should there be a large quantity of standing water, you might require a water pump for removal. When marginal water is left, you can soak up the remainder with old sh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Area

You can additionally set up electric followers and also put them in the greatest setup. A dehumidifier likewise works in taking out dampness to protect against mold as well as molds.

7. Deal with Specialists

When you experience extensive water damages due to emergency flooding from a burst pipeline, you can deal with a repair specialist to reconstruct and also renovate your residence. Above all, don't fail to remember to call a reliable plumbing professional to repair the ruptured pipe and inspect the remainder of your piping system. Making It Through the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one location, you should be utilized now on what to do, where to go as well as what to need to be prepared for poor weather condition. If you're not made use of to getting mauled by high winds as well as hard rain, you probably don't have an suggestion just how finest to deal with a storm situation.

For beginners,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ations monitor the atmosphere all the time. If a storm is possible, they will release 2 kinds of cautions:

Storm watch-- is issued when there is a possible storm in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an abnormally gusty day and some rainfall. The tornado may or might not come, yet this is the moment to maintain tuned to your local radio for news and upd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ed toward your location. Try to remain indoors as high as feasible. Or if residents are advised to evacuate to a much safer location, go as early as you can. Don't wait up until the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be swamped and web traffic is bad. You do not wish to be captured in your auto in bad weather condition.

Blizzard-- normally happens in winter season as well as suggests heavy snow, strong winds and wind cool. When a warning is issued, prevent taking a trip as long as possible as well as remain inside your home. There is no use exposing yourself outdoors where you could obtain caught in traffic or in locations where you will certainly be tough to get to or worse, find.

For all our innovation, nobody can stop a storm from coming. The only means to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ency. Points don't constantly spoil throughout tornados, but climate is unpredictable as well as anything can take place. To help you prepare for a tornado emergency, right here are a few pointers:

Spruce up.
Use enough garments to maintain on your own cozy. Warmth may not be readily available in your residence so obtain additional layers and also blankets to keep your body temperature level adequately.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ots all set also.

Have food prepared.
Emergency situation arrangements are a need to during storm emergency situations. If the tornado gets also bad and also the streets are flooded, you will certainly have a trouble going out to the grocery store stores.

Maintain containers of water convenient. Tidy water might be tough to find by throughout really negative conditions as well as the most awful thing you can do is struggle with d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at the very least one gallon for every single individual da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ill the tub.
You'll need much more water for washing and flushing the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your bath t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have small children in your house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and also maintaining youngsters away from the restroom unless necessary.

Emergency kit
Have a medical or initial package all set and also see to it it's freshly-stocked. It must have dis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as required medications. It's additionally a excellent suggestion to have another set in your cars and truck.

If any person in your family members is under special drug, see to it you have enough products to last up until after the storm is over and also drug stores are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power failures throughout storm emergency situations. You will not have any kind of electrical energy, so supply on candle lights,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ries as well as matches in case you go out.

If you can not swit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will certainly monitor the tornado as well as will maintain you updated.

You might require warm water during the duration when power is not yet readily available, so keep a little tank of gas around just in case. Your outside gas grill will do perfectly.

Obtain an alternate sanctuary.
Make certain you have sufficient gas in your container in instance you require to get out of the residence as well as move some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have better opportunities of being secure and also completely dry.
